9 Easy Facts About L1 Visa Delhi Shown Table of ContentsThe Main Principles Of L1 Visa Delhi L1 Visa Delhi for DummiesL1 Visa Delhi Fundamentals ExplainedEverything about L1 Visa DelhiGetting The L1 Visa Delhi To WorkLittle Known Facts About L1 Visa Delhi.For private L1 visas, the processing time usually varies https://jordanqzri321blog.ampblogs.com/getting-my-l1-visa-delhi-to-work-73758342